When is happiness possible?

Exhibition by h.arta group

Is happiness an individual matter, is it possible in the vicinity of others` unhappiness? In a context of extreme right discourses becoming increasingly visible in the public space, where the intrusion of capital in all aspects of society being increasingly obvious, where losing the inalienable rights such as water and clean air are lost, and the extreme disrespect for life becomes acceptable, how to overcome the idea of happiness as a prescription, of happiness as a duty of the neoliberal individual? The project examines the promotion of violence, the removal and concealment of those unhappy, the double standards, the transforming of despair and poverty in individual guilt in a society where the word "happiness" follows us from billboards, from media, from the norms of everyday life.

The exhibition is open between 17 April - 19 May 2014.
Visiting hours: Monday to Friday from 3:00 to 6:00 pm

h.arta is a group of 3 women artists (Maria Crista, Anca Gyemant and Rodica Tache) whose projects focus on knowledge production and alternative educational models in a feminist frame. We use different forms and formats, such as events, discussions,
publications, everyday objects attempting to create new spaces for political expression and action. Our projects are most of the time based on collaboration and we frequently work together with other artists, human rights activists, schools, etc. Our methodology is based on friendship, which we understand as an everyday negotiation of
differences, as a way of learning from each other, and as a political statement about the power of solidarity.
